Wolters Kluwer’s LegalVIEW-based study draws from more than $200 billion in invoice data and reports sharp regional contrasts, including top-25 partner rate growth of 6.3% mean in 2025, New York partner and associate benchmarks, and double-digit increases in some regional markets. This is valuable for Inside Legal Economics because it supports a more sophisticated pricing conversation than “rates are up”: geography, practice, role, scarcity and client leverage all matter.
